Faucet Repair in Denver, CO
Faucet repair services address issues related to leaking, dripping, or malfunctioning kitchen and bathroom faucets. These projects typically involve fixing or replacing worn-out washers, seals, cartridges, or valve components to restore proper function and prevent water waste. Homeowners often seek faucet repairs when experiencing persistent leaks, low water pressure, or difficulty turning the handles, aiming to improve convenience and conserve water in their homes.
Before requesting faucet repair services, property owners should consider the type of faucet installed, such as compression, cartridge, ball, or ceramic disc models, as different repair methods may be required. It’s also helpful to identify the specific problem, whether it’s a leak, noise, or difficulty operating the faucet, and to determine if any visible damage or corrosion is present. Having this information ready can assist in ensuring the repair process is efficient and effective.

Faucet Repair Questions
What are common signs of a faucet needing repair? Dripping sounds, water pooling around the base, decreased water flow, or leaks are typical indicators of faucet issues.
Can a damaged faucet be repaired or does it need replacement? Many faucet problems, such as leaks or handle issues, can often be fixed without replacing the entire fixture.
What types of faucet repairs are typically requested? Repairs often involve fixing leaks, replacing washers or cartridges, and restoring proper water flow.
Is it necessary to shut off water supply before repair? Yes, turning off the water supply is essential before starting any faucet repair to prevent water damage.
